Linux 版 (精华区)

发信人: netiscpu (还没想好), 信区: Linux
标  题: [M] LINUX下中文的好消息!
发信站: 紫 丁 香 (Thu Sep 10 19:20:43 1998), 转信


        [注] 本文转自SLUG Mailing List.

        [原作者] "Eric Genius" <helios@online.sh.cn> 

大家好!

    我下载了宫博士的ZHXWIN,配合KDE和SUN的字体
(字体文件的话可能有版权问题,但不管了),界面
非常好看。我介绍一下我的安装过程:

1。取得ZHXWIN(废话!),你可以到
http://freesoft.cei.gov.cn 下载或
http://www.compat.online.sh.cn/free/linux 。

2。我在KDE下,利用libst.so.4实现了标题框显示
中文,其他窗口管理器没试过,fvwm可能可以。
Motif和OpenWin的都和libst.so有冲突。

3。安装ZhXwin。一般安装时会有三个问题,
一个是安装前运行一次updatedb。
一个是安装后修改$HOME/Chinput.ad使其中的CXTERM
指向合适的目录
最后一个是启动X前,要有环境变量$LD_PRELOAD=
/usr/local/ZhXwin/lib/libst.so.4,目录根据
具体安装时的目录,别忘了export LD_PRELOAD。

4。取得SUN的中文字体(比CXTERM的老粗黑字体好看多
了,不过可能涉及到版权问题,希望大家不要到处张扬:-)
你可以到http://studio.sinet.net.cn/pub/chinese/GB/fonts
下找到,把整个sun-song目录拉下来。
我自己是在/usr/X11R6/lib/X11/fonts下另建一个sun-song
目录,然后把字体拷进去,因为如果sun-song全拉下来
的话,它已经有fonts.alias, fonts.dir了,用不到mkfontdir
了,如果想把它拷到别的目录,别忘了mkfontdir。还有
在XF86Config中字体路径一节中加上新字体的路径。

5。运行KDE,运行NETSCAPE,哇,爽!访问中文站点,标题
框是中文的,还有网页中的下拉菜单也变成中文了。不过
NETSCAPE2。0的好象下拉菜单显示中文不行。就用4.0吧,
就是太慢了点。还有顺便说一下,如果觉得CXTERM的字体
不顺眼,可以命令行中加个参数
-fh "xxx-xxx-xxxxxx" 指定显示的中文字体,可以用
xfontsel先看看那种字体好。或者在Xdefault文件中加上
cxterm*hanziFont:"xxx-xxx-xxxxxx",省的每次都要
指定。

6。libst.so.4使用程序指定的字体,所以中文字会超出
标题框。找到ZhXwin的源程序,进入libst目录下有一个
cxlib.c文件,修改里面的#define ...font "xxx-xx-xxx"
具体忘了,大家自己找吧,该成你要的字体,然后
make
用新编译的libst代替原来的,就大功搞成了。

好了,快动手吧。过几天, 我会把字体上载到我的网址
ftp://www.compat.online.sh.cn/freehomepage/linux 下,
不过不会出现在主页中,请见谅。

各位如果成功的话,别忘了给大伙发封信!而且可以
把WIN95仍掉了,爽不爽,嘿嘿!


--

                              Enjoy Linux!
                          -----It's FREE!-----

※ 来源:.紫 丁 香 bbs.hit.edu.cn.[FROM: mtlab.hit.edu.cn]
[百宝箱] [返回首页] [上级目录] [根目录] [返回顶部] [刷新] [返回]
Powered by KBS BBS 2.0 (http://dev.kcn.cn)
页面执行时间:3.935毫秒